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- Whether a sequential test is required and whether the occupiers of the proposed replacement dwelling would be at risk of flooding
What decided it
The safety of residential occupiers would be greater than at present, with future residents not at risk of flooding, which outweighed the conflict with the development plan arising from the absence of a sequential test.
